  3. WHAT IS ASPAC? (Ateneo Schools Parents Council) ASPAC is the first duly constituted association of parents of college students in the Ateneo de Manila University It was founded by Fr. Raul Bonoan, S.J. in 1985 and serves as a means for parents to participate in the process of guiding their children’s educational growth, in partnership with the school.

  4. MISSION and VISION ASPAC aims to strengthen the working relationship of the parents, students, teachers and the Ateneo community. It is envisioned that this working relationship will ultimately benefit our children in terms of • a HIGHER QUALITY EDUCATION • STRONG MORAL FIBER • a TRULY ALIVE SPIRIT OF SERVICE for others and the country • MORE RESPONSIVENESS to academic concerns and student affairs

  5. A.S.P.A.CACTS AS A VEHICLE THROUGH WHICH… • Ateneo parents and legal guardians get actively involved in their children’s education and growth. • Ateneo parents and legal guardians can continue to grow and reach out to community organizations. • Ateneo parents and legal guardians can bond with other parents, Administration, Faculty, and Students.

  6. MEMBERS ALL PARENTS and LEGAL GUARDIANS of the students of the different SCHOOLS OF LOYOLA are automatically members of ASPAC. Upon registration of their children, they are assessed minimal membership dues per semester.

  7. 1 HOW CAN YOU BE INVOLVED? Volunteer as your YEAR LEVEL REPRESENTATIVE nominee Eight (8) members representing two (2) from each school.

  8. 2 HOW CAN YOU BE INVOLVED? Parents and legal guardians are enjoined to volunteer as COMMITTEE MEMBER in any or all of the following Committees ACADEMICS Spearheads ASPAC’s search for the Outstanding Teachers and takes lead in discussions on Academic Concerns amongst Parents, Students and Administrators.

  9. 2 HOW CAN YOU BE INVOLVED? Parents and legal guardians are enjoined to volunteer as COMMITTEE MEMBER in any or all of the following Committees COMMUNICATIONS, PUBLIC RELATIONS and PUBLICATIONS Handles all ASPAC Publications and takes charge of disseminating information of all ASPAC activities.

  10. 2 HOW CAN YOU BE INVOLVED? Parents and legal guardians are enjoined to volunteer as COMMITTEE MEMBER in any or all of the following Committees GOVERNMENT AFFAIRS Takes a stand on government issues which affect the studentry and handles all external issues referred to the Ateneo Parents Sector in aid of legislation.

  11. 2 HOW CAN YOU BE INVOLVED? Parents and legal guardians are enjoined to volunteer as COMMITTEE MEMBER in any or all of the following Committees SCHOLARSHIP Provides scholarship grants and guidance to students qualified by Office of Admission and Aid (OAA).

  12. 2 HOW CAN YOU BE INVOLVED? Parents and legal guardians are enjoined to volunteer as COMMITTEE MEMBER in any or all of the following Committees SECURITY Acts as a liaison to enhance/upgrade security measures and to maintain the physical safety of the students within the campus.

  13. 2 HOW CAN YOU BE INVOLVED? Parents and legal guardians are enjoined to volunteer as COMMITTEE MEMBER in any or all of the following Committees WAYS and MEANS COMMITTEE Which acts as the logistics arm of A.S.P.A.C.
